Harrison And Rodrigo On Fire For Leeds
Burnley 0 Leeds United 4
Leeds turned in what was perhaps their best performance of the season despite starting each half sluggishly but their finishing as Burnley manager Sean Dyche said is his post match briefing to the press was clinical. Bamford went close midway through the half but he found ex teammate and Northern Ireland goalkeeper Peacock-Farrell in fine form. Then two minutes before the half time whistle Polish International Mateusz Klich curled in a beautiful effort from outside the box as Leeds hit The Clarets on the break.
This seemed to spur the home side on who started the second half in excellent form and Matej Vydra was thwarted by the outstretched leg of Illan Meslier from what looked a certain equaliser.
